Adjective[edit]

gearless (not comparable)

  1. Without gears.
    • 1950 September, “Central London Railway Jubilee”, in Railway Magazine, page 620:
      These locomotives, which were finished in crimson lake livery with gold lining and lettering, were not considered very satisfactory, for their gearless motors, with armatures mounted directly on the axles, set up considerable vibration.
